Deutsches Simutransforum

Normale Version: Was mache ich falsch? pak/dat
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
guten Tag,

ich habe mich mal an dat schreiben begenben.

und folgende Dat funkioniert nicht.

Code:
obj=vehicle
name=super_Tube_ER
waytype=tram_track
freight=Passagiere
payload=124
speed=300
power=2000
length=8
gear=100
cost=125
weight=5
runningcost=001
intro_year=1964
intro_month=3
retire_year=2050
retire_month=9
engine_type=electric
sound=5
EmptyImage[S]=GT.0.0
EmptyImage[W]=GT.1.1
EmptyImage[SE]=GT.0.2
EmptyImage[SW]=GT.1.3
EmptyImage[N]=GT.1.0
EmptyImage[E]=GT.0.1
EmptyImage[NW]=GT.1.2
EmptyImage[NE]=GT.0.3

habe sie mit dem Befehl makeobj PAK verpackt, aber sie steht nit im Depot.

Warum ist was am code falsch?
Das Leerzeichen vor obj darf nicht sein. Ansonsten schau die mal http://simutrans-germany.com/wiki/wiki/t...leDef&bl=y an.

Vielleicht hast du auch einen Fehler in der PNG-Bilddatei? Lad die auch mal hoch, dann können wir schauen.

Bei Bildern kann man ein paar Fehler machen. z.B. den Alphakanal mitspeichern oder die genau vorgeschriebene Grafikgröße nicht beachtet.
hab das Bild geschwärtst, da mein Freund den Zug gepaintet hat!
Wenn Du das Leerzeichen vor obj wegmachst, kommt eine (von der Größe her) stimmige .pak Datei raus (67,3kb). Mit dem Leerzeichen drin, hat sie dagegen nur 69 Byte (und da kann dann auch nix im Depot stehen).
Code:
obj=vehicle name=super_Tube_ER Copyright=Manuel waytype=electrified_track freight=Passagiere payload=240 speed=300 power=2000 length=8 gear=200cost=001 cost=125 weight=5 RunningCost=001 intro_year=1964 intro_month=3 retire_year=2050 retire_month=9 engine_type=electricEmptyImage[S]=GT.0.0 EmptyImage[W]=GT.1.1 EmptyImage[SE]=GT.0.3 EmptyImage[SW]=GT.1.2 EmptyImage[N]=GT.1.0 EmptyImage[E]=GT.0.1 EmptyImage[NW]=GT.1.3 EmptyImage[NE]=GT.0.2
geht
Code:
obj=vehicle name=super_Tube_ER Copyright=Manuel waytype=tram_track freight=Passagiere payload=240 speed=300 power=2000 length=8 gear=200cost=001 cost=125 weight=5 RunningCost=001 intro_year=1964 intro_month=3 retire_year=2050 retire_month=9 engine_type=electricEmptyImage[S]=GT.0.0 EmptyImage[W]=GT.1.1 EmptyImage[SE]=GT.0.3 EmptyImage[SW]=GT.1.2 EmptyImage[N]=GT.1.0 EmptyImage[E]=GT.0.1 EmptyImage[NW]=GT.1.3 EmptyImage[NE]=GT.0.2
geht nicht

Warum macht tram_track Probleme?

Wurzelgnom

Zitat:Original von PorscheTaurus
....

Warum macht tram_track Probleme?

falsche ( zu alte ) Makeobject-/Simutrans-Version
Neuste Simutrans-Version

und Makeobj v0.1.7 ob es eine Neuere gibt weiß ich nicht?
hab mir mal MakeObject Script Engine 0.4.1 runtergeladen
hoffe es ist das neuste

EDIT:
es geht danke
Zitat:Original von PorscheTaurus
hab mir mal MakeObject Script Engine 0.4.1 runtergeladen
hoffe es ist das neuste

MakeObject Script Engine ist aber nicht das was du suchst. (Wenn ich dich richtig verstanden habe) Aber ja 0.4.1 ist die neuste Stable.
MakeObject Script Engine ist nicht MakeObj

Solltest du wircklich nach MOSE suchen, dann ließ dir mal das MOSEWiki durch: http://sourceforge.net/apps/mediawiki/mo...=Main_Page

Zitat:Orginal von PorscheTaurus
Makeobj v0.1.7
Wir sind bei MakeObj 49, v0.1.7 klingt nach einer MOSE Versionsnummer.


Download MakeObj: http://sourceforge.net/projects/simutrans/files/